    Best greenbacks for Roadking II

    Here are the spec's for the speakers. The last list of spec's is for the 70th anniversery G12H these have the black sticker with a 75hz cone and are made in China, if that is good or bad that is up to you, do not confuse those with the U.K made Herritage G12H as these are made with the 55hz...
  9. L

    Best greenbacks for Roadking II

    Going back before I switched heads, I was using a Roadking V1 and: I put a quad of the Celestion G12H-30s, not the one with the black sticker but the (H) for heavy-large magnet greenback version. The cone has a 55hz res. over the 75hz res. of the others. These speakers are really efficient. I...
